Transaction 6528bc9254de51b91246ee069850ed0b7b6098e10def2628f85c40c3e2085638
1 Input
1 Output
-
6528bc9254de51b91246ee069850ed0b7b6098e10def2628f85c40c3e2085638:0
- value
- 2490349
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ef389ba99ca8fccaddd89070a0526b025f305c7 OP_EQUAL
- address
- 33458YejhAAvhnxf5REASwCT2oZh2GNNGj